Department/Unit Summary The Float Pool Registered Nurse (RN) provides high-quality, patient-centered care across various units within the hospital. This position supports multiple clinical areas and is responsible for delivering nursing care based on established clinical practices and nursing standards. The RN Float Pool adapts quickly to new environments and collaborates effectively with multidisciplinary teams to ensure optimal patient outcomes How you’ll contribute You’ll make an impact by utilizing your specialized plan-of-care intervention and serving as a patient-care innovator. Requirements

  • Applicants should have a current state RN license
  • Applicants should possess a bachelor’s degree from an accredited nursing school.
  • Basic Life Support certification is required within 30 days of hire.
  • One year of experience preferred

Nice To Haves

  • ASLS certification preferred
  • ACLS certification preferred
